Answer the following question in one or two words/sentences:

In what way would be westernized Indians help to promote the interests of British manufacturers?

Short Answer
Advertisements

Solution

  1. The British system of education produced English-speaking Indian graduates who helped their British masters to run the empire.
  2. It also created a class of Indians who were Westernized to the extent that they rejected Indian culture and patronized anything and everything that was British including British goods.
